Mola Badha

Mola Badha is a village located in Malerkotla tehsil of Sangrur district in Punjab, India. It is situated 22km away from sub-district headquarter Malerkotla (tehsildar office) and 41km away from district headquarter Sangrur. As per 2009 stats, Mullabadda is the gram panchayat of Mola Badha village.

About Mola Badha

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Mola Badha is 039518. The village spans a total geographical area of 225 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 148022. Malerkotla is nearest town to Mola Badha village for all major economic activities.

Population of Mola Badha

According to the 2011 Census, Mola Badha has a total population of about 1,025, with approximately 542 males and 483 females. The sex ratio is around 891 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 131 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 496 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 66.83%, with male literacy at about 70.11% and female literacy near 63.15%. There are around 184 households in the village. Connectivity of Mola Badha

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Mola Badha. As per the 2011 stats, Mola Badha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
